In geometry, a line is a perfectly straight one-dimensional figure extending infinitely in both directions. There are two subsets, or subcategories, of lines in geometry: line segments and rays.

In geometry, a line is a perfectly straight one-dimensional figure extending infinitely in both directions.
A line can be named either using two points on the line (for example, ↔AB ) or simply by a letter, usually lowercase (for example, line m ). A line segment has two endpoints. It contains these endpoints and all the points of the line between them.
There are two subsets, or subcategories, of lines in geometry: line segments and rays.
